AI Summary
Wieland Austria Ges.m.b.H. is a well-established manufacturing company specializing in copper tubes and semi-finished and finished copper alloy products. Founded in 1904 and part of the global Wieland Group since 1999, it holds a strong market position in Europe with modern production sites in Amstetten and Enzesfeld, Austria. The company targets industrial and energy sectors, providing engineered products and services with a focus on quality and sustainability. The website reflects a professional digital presence with comprehensive content, certifications, and contact options. Technically, the site uses modern CMS and caching technologies but lacks a valid SSL certificate, which is a critical security concern. Privacy compliance is well addressed with a consent management platform and clear policies. However, the absence of incident response and vulnerability disclosure information indicates room for improvement in security transparency. Overall, the website is credible and professional but requires urgent SSL/TLS remediation to ensure secure communications and trust.

Security Posture Analysis
Comprehensive Security Assessment
The website’s security posture is currently weak due to the lack of a valid SSL certificate and absence of modern TLS protocols, which exposes users to potential interception risks. While security headers like HSTS are present, they are ineffective without proper HTTPS. The site uses consent management and spam protection on forms, indicating awareness of privacy and security best practices. However, missing DNSSEC, CAA records, and no visible incident response or vulnerability disclosure policies highlight gaps in comprehensive security governance. The overall security score is low, and immediate remediation of SSL/TLS issues is critical to protect user data and maintain trust.
